Northeast Design Firm Wins International Charity Competition
Founded in 1992, Canstruction is an international charity competition in which teams of architects, engineers, and contractors build large, vibrant structures entirely out of canned goods. The structures are put on public display and voted on, with winners of the citywide competitions moving on to the international competition. After the structures are taken down, the canned goods used to build them are sent to food banks in the community.
